Job Information

Madison County Government Administrative Assistant in Anderson, Indiana

The Problem-Solving Court of Madison County is seeking qualified candidates for the below listed position. If interested, please provide a resume to Katie Stapleton, Coordinator of Problem-Solving Courts, 16 E. 9^th^ St., Suite 403, Anderson, IN 46016 or kstapleton@madisoncounty.in.gov. Resumes must be received by 4:00 pm, Friday, March 8, 2024, to ensure consideration. Job Description Position: Administrative Assistant Department: Madison County Problem Solving Courts of Madison County Work Schedule: Monday-Friday 8 a.m. to 4 p.m.

Job Category: Support staff

PSC Administrative Assistant Breakdown of Job Duties

Add all anomalies (missed, CNP, labs, positive sticks) to Unusual Screens spreadsheet.

Send daily screening report email to team.

Data entry of individual screen sheet info and lab results. Anomaly sheets and lab results paperwork gets filed, lab sheets get put in the Pending Billing file, and all others get set aside temporarily (recycle sheets at end of the month, keeping only two weeks' worth).

Check Cordant website for lab results. Print result documentation to attach to lab sheets.

Send lab results report email to team.

Create invoices for all labs (exception: BASELINE), add cost to Fees spreadsheet, distribute invoices to CM, and build charge into Odyssey.

Log client payment amounts from receipts in Fees spreadsheet.

Make copies of handbooks and all materials for new client folders for Drug, Mental Health, and Reentry courts.

Add new clients to Fees spreadsheet

Maintain New Client Fees Calendar, which shows start date in PSC program and the date (six weeks later) user fees start.

Make bulk copies of screen sheets and Drop sheets, as needed.

Create claims for invoices and get Judge's signature. Copy and prep signed claims to submit to Auditing.

Maintain ledgers for all grants and funds used to pay expenses by PSC.

Reconcile ledger totals with Low Financial System to make sure that balances match.
